**Handover Note – Reseller Programme**

Welcome aboard, Tomas! The Brightquill reseller programme is in decent shape — 14 active partners, with Calverton Systems our strongest performer. Margins are set quarterly; Ines handles the partner portal. Watch the onboarding backlog, it drifts. Full files are in the shared drive. One thing I'd flag before you meet the partners next week.

internal memo for kaduf-baduf: Only 35 of the 378 pilot accounts renewed Holir, so a churn review is set for June 11. Eliielax Group is in early talks to buy Silaelix Group for about $142.1 million.

## Support

If `tailhound` fails to attach to a log stream during a release window, first confirm that the target pod is in the Running state and that your session token has not expired. Known issues, including the intermittent buffer stall on multi-region tails, are tracked in the Tailhound runbook under the Release Tooling space. Please include the full command invocation, the stream identifier, and the approximate timestamp in any report. For urgent release-blocking problems, reach the Tailhound maintainers directly at the address below.

escalation mailbox, bafog-fafog: ulador@paliqlabs.internal

### Recovering the Consent Banner Admin Account

So the Noticeboard rollout admin got locked out again — happens more than you'd think, usually mid-rollout when someone fat-fingers the staging login. Pause the banner rollout in Tidewell first so regions don't drift. Then hit the recovery flow, and when it asks, type in the passphrase below.

vault phrase of tajef-tafog = istox-sorax-zorox-casok-holox-kelix-weneth-drueth-casion

**Ticket: Signature check failing on hollyframe-ui v4.2.1**

Hey folks — installs of the shared component library hollyframe-ui are bombing out with a signature mismatch since the 4.2.1 bump. Looks like the package was re-signed during the versioning cleanup but the registry still advertises the old key. Quick fix for anyone blocked: pin to 4.2.0 or trust the new signer manually. For reference, the new signing key is pasted below.

deploy key for kajof-fajop: bky6_gDHw9Q